ASAP: Which conclusion can be drawn based on the true statements shown?

If a triangle is equilateral, then all the sides in the triangle are congruent.
If all the sides in a triangle are congruent, then all the angles are congruent.

Based on the law of syllogism, if all the angles in a triangle are congruent, then the triangle is equilateral.
Based on the law of detachment, if all the angles in a triangle are congruent, then the triangle is equilateral.
Based on the law of syllogism, if a triangle is equilateral, then all the angles are congruent.
Based on the law of detachment, if a triangle is equilateral, then all the angles are congruent.

Respuesta :

Answer:

Conclusion:

Based on the law of syllogism, if a triangle is equilateral, then all the angles are congruent.

Step-by-step explanation:

The law of syllogism, also called reasoning by transitivity, is a valid argument form of deductive reasoning that follows a set pattern. It is similar to the transitive property of equality, which reads: if a = b and b = c then, a = c.

In syllogism, we combine two or more logical statements into one logical statement.

Statement 1:

If a triangle is equilateral, then all the sides in the triangle are congruent.

Statement 2:

If all the sides in a triangle are congruent, then all the angles are congruent.

Concluded Statement using law of syllogism:

Based on the law of syllogism, if a triangle is equilateral, then all the angles are congruent.
